技术进步中的三大支柱算法是什么
在人工智能的发展历程中,随着技术的不断进步和创新,一系列先进算法逐渐被应用于不同的领域。这些算法不仅推动了人工智能技术的快速发展,也极大地提升了数据处理和分析能力。其中,深度学习、决策树与支持向量机这三种算法尤其受到了广泛关注,因为它们是目前人工智能研究中最为关键和基础的一部分。
首先,我们要探讨的是深度学习。在这个术语下,最核心的概念就是神经网络,它模仿了生物体内神经细胞之间相互连接并传递信息的方式。通过构建多层次相互作用的人工神经网络,可以实现复杂任务,如图像识别、自然语言处理等。这一方法利用大量数据来训练模型,使得计算机能够从无数个例子中学到如何进行预测或决策,并且在很多情况下表现出超越人类水平的准确性。
接着,我们来看决策树。这是一种用于分类或回归问题的人工智能模型,其工作原理是将数据按照特征值划分成更小规模的问题集,以此形成一个树状结构。当我们想要对新的实例进行分类时,可以通过跟踪该实例沿着每个节点所走过的路径,最终得到一个类别标签或预测值。这种方法简单直观,而且易于理解,但当面对高维或者包含噪声数据时,可能会遇到过拟合问题,这意味着模型记住了训练过程中的噪声而不是规律。
最后,不得不提及支持向量机(SVM),它是一种监督式学习算法,主要用于解决二分类问题,即将输入空间中的实例分配到两个类别之一。但不同于之前提到的两种方法,SVM采用了一种独特的手段:寻找最佳超平面以最大化两个类别间距离,从而使得新样本可以正确分类。此外,由于SVM使用线性可分边界,对非线性可分的问题也能找到近似解,因此非常适合那些难以用单纯线性关系描述的问题场景,比如手写数字识别。
虽然上述三大支柱算法各有千秋,每一种都有自己强大的优势和应用范围,但它们之间存在一定程度上的交叉。在某些情境下,将这些工具结合起来,就能创造出更加强大的系统,比如将深度学习与决策树结合使用,以提高模型稳定性;又或者是在特定的条件下选择适当类型的情境下的SVM运用,以优化性能。
然而,在探索这些技术时,也不可忽视它们潜在带来的挑战。一方面,为了让AI真正具有“智慧”,需要更多高质量、高效率的大型数据库作为训练材料,这对于资源有限的小型企业来说是一个巨大的障碍。此外,由于AI系统依赖大量的人为设置,所以如果没有足够精细微调,它们可能无法达到最佳效果。而另一方面,更复杂的人工智能系统也带来了隐私保护和安全性的挑战,因为它们能够访问敏感信息并执行高度自动化操作,而如果未加以控制,则可能导致严重后果。
总结来说,无论是在学术研究还是工业界应用中,“人工智能三大支柱”——深度学习、决策树与支持向量机,都扮演着至关重要角色。如果我们希望继续推动AI前沿发展,那么必须持续投资研发新技术,同时努力克服现有挑战,为未来世界构筑更加安全、公正、透明的人工智能生态环境。